Poem titled "War Song of the Spanish Patriots" by Louisa Crawford, 7 March 1823
Item
Identifier: Coll-1839/3/1/5
Scope and Contents
Poem titled "War Song of the Spanish Patriots" by Louisa Crawford. A note reading "Recd. fm. my beloved" identifies the recipient as her husband, Matthew Crawford. The first lines read, "Hark, hark, 'tis the war Trump, it summons the free / To fight for the Land of the noble and fair, / Then onward my Comrades, and Gallia shall see / If her slaves with the Patriots of Spain can compare."
